Running head Effects of water quality on a freshwater bivalve Abstract Water quality was monitored along an Andean river of global importance using the freshwater bivalve Diplodon chilensis as sentinel species. Bivalves were placed in cages at three sites (S1-3) in the Chimehuin river in order to evaluate the long-term effects of a trout hatchery (S2), and the open dump and sewage treatment plant of a nearby city (S3).
